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ase "in spite of the hardships faced" is correct and usable in written English.
You can use it to express resilience or perseverance despite difficulties encountered in a situation. Example: "In spite of the hardships faced, the community came together to support one another during the crisis."

Expert writing Tips
Best practice
Use the phrase "in spite of the hardships faced" to highlight resilience and determination in overcoming significant obstacles. Ensure the context clearly demonstrates the challenges and the positive outcome or continued effort despite them.
Common error
Avoid using "in spite of the hardships faced" for minor inconveniences. This phrase is best reserved for situations involving genuinely significant challenges, not trivial setbacks.

Linguistic Context
The phrase "in spite of the hardships faced" functions as an adverbial phrase that modifies a verb or clause, indicating that an action or result occurs even though significant difficulties were present. Ludwig's analysis confirms its use in expressing resilience and overcoming adversity.

FAQs
How can I use "in spite of the hardships faced" in a sentence?
You can use "in spite of the hardships faced" to emphasize resilience or perseverance. For example, "In spite of the hardships faced, the community came together to rebuild the town".
What are some alternatives to "in spite of the hardships faced"?
Alternatives include "despite the difficulties encountered", "notwithstanding the challenges experienced", or "even with the obstacles presented", depending on the context.
When is it appropriate to use "in spite of the hardships faced"?
Use it when you want to highlight that someone or something has succeeded or persevered despite facing significant challenges or difficulties.
Is there a difference between "in spite of the hardships faced" and "despite the hardships faced"?
The phrases are very similar and often interchangeable. "Despite" is slightly more common, but "in spite of" carries a similar meaning and impact.
